Vampyr resurrected with new difficulty modes

Vampyr

Dontnod Entertainment has announced a new update for the bloodsucking adventure that is Vampyr. The patch will add new game options as well as a coffin-load of bug fixes when it releases later this summer.

The two new modes exist on opposite ends of the difficulty spectrum, and allow Vampyr players new and old to experience the story in new ways. Hard mode does what it says on the tin, by making the enemies tougher and reducing XP rewards and upgrade availability. If the original experience was too easy for you, this should provide a nice new challenge.

Players can also have the option of playing through the campaign via the new ‘Story’ mode, which puts combat to the rear while forefronting the story above all else. If you just wanted to experience the narrative of the game, this is the option for you.
